* Starred Review Booklist. "Chess Hanrahan, the book-loving New York City gumshoe who's prone to tunnel vision when something gets under his skin, deserves a much wider readership. . . . Hanrahan is a great character, a guy who values literature, loves movies, despises stupidity and duplicity, and, when he gets working on a puzzle, absolutely will not stop until he's solved it. Fans of detective fiction . . . will love this novel--and all of Cline's work." (David Pitt, Booklist, May 2011) One impossible thing--a movie script credited to a man who couldn't have written it--sets Chess Hanrahan on the trail of a killer in the third novel of this series described as "exceptionally strong" (Allen J. Hubin, The Armchair Detective). Advertising: Mystery Scene; Crime Spree
